Nomadix earns Marriott’s approval for gateway

Nomadix's EG 1000 internet gateway has earned brand approval by Marriott International for use at select service brands, including Four Points by Sheraton, Courtyard, Residence Inn, SpringHill Suites, Fairfield Inn & Suites, TownePlace Suites, Protea Hotels, AC Hotels, Element, Aloft and Moxy.

The EG 1000 builds on the normal Nomadix features and functionalities but into a compact format and a lower price point that makes it appealing for smaller properties. The solution provides resilient, secure and compliant connectivity, enabling personalized experiences with multiple plan and service options.

The companies expect the gateway to provide frictionless Wi-Fi connectivity to more easily stream shows, make video calls and play games. As such, they expect the service to reduce troubleshooting calls to associates.
